负载均衡理论路径涉及多个层面和策略,旨在优化资源使用,最大化吞吐率,并最小化响应时间,以此避免任何单一资源的过载,负载均衡可以通过多种方式实现,包括DNS负载均衡、硬件负载均衡、软件负载均衡等。

(图片来源网络,侵删)
1、DNS负载均衡:用于全球范围内的负载均衡,它通过识别用户的地理位置,将请求导向最近的服务器,以此提高访问速度,这种策略适用于数据与请求需要保持均衡的场景,如分库分表进行分片hash负载。
2、硬件负载均衡:借助专业的硬件设备来实现负载均衡,这些设备通常具有高效处理网络流量的能力,并能支持各种复杂的负载均衡算法。
3、软件负载均衡:通过软件来实现负载均衡功能,例如使用LVS(Linux Virtual Server),它提供了DR、NAT和Tunnel三种模式,可以根据实际情况选择最合适的负载均衡策略。
4、本地负载均衡:基于目标网络的负载均衡是根据目标地址分配负载,例如Cisco的快速转发(CEF)的缺省负载均衡方式是按照轮流的方式将数据包分发到不同的路径上。
负载均衡的理论路径涉及DNS、硬件、软件等多种实现方式,每种方式都有其独特的工作原理和适用场景,合理选择和配置负载均衡策略,不仅可以优化资源使用,还可以提高系统的可靠性和冗余性,同时有效地应对高并发和突发流量,保障服务的持续可用性和性能。

(图片来源网络,侵删)
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复